Baked apples with cinnamon and Greek yogurt

“Baked apples with cinnamon and a Greek vanilla yogurt is a dessert that will delight both your palate and your heart,” Dr. Blake assures us. All of the ingredients in this simple recipe work together to add not only great flavor, but health benefits as well.

For starters, apples are a wonderful fruit, naturally sweet and high in fiber. Apples are rich in viscous soluble fiber, which has been shown to help lower blood cholesterol levels, says Dr. Blake. Keeping your cholesterol low is an important part of reducing your risk of heart disease, and adding the right foods to your diet is a great way to do that.

As Blake explains, viscous soluble fiber like the kind found in apples can prevent the reabsorption of high-cholesterol bile acids released by the gallbladder to help the intestines digest fat. “Your body replaces these lost bile acids by removing cholesterol from the blood to produce new bile acids in the liver. As a result, your blood cholesterol levels decrease.”

By adding cinnamon to these fibrous fruits, you can take both the flavor and health benefits a step further. Cinnamon adds a natural sweetness, so you don’t need to add added sugar to the apples before baking. A diet rich in added sugars also increases the risk of heart disease. Additionally, cinnamon has been shown to have anti-inflammatory properties, which is another important benefit for your overall health, including heart health.

Craving something creamy to go with your baked apples? Skip the ice cream and go straight for Greek yogurt instead. It’s a high-protein, probiotic-rich treat that’s packed with health benefits. In addition to keeping the gut happy and balanced, it may also help lower cholesterol and triglyceride levels.
